Dendriscocaulon intricatulum (Nyl.) Henssen

Characters[*]:Character States[*]:
global occurrence: Americas – North America (incl Mexico)
substrate: bark, cork, plant surface – trunks, branches, twigs
life habit: lichenized (mutualistic with algal photobionts)
thallus: fruticose (fruticous), shrub-like, beard-like
[th] upper surface: red(dish) brown (if pale: orange brown) | blue(ish) red (purple)
[th marginal and upper surface] specific structures: absent | present
[th] morphol substructures (eg areoles, lobes, branches) width [mm]: (low) 0.07 (high) 0.1
[th] morphol substructures (eg lobes, branches): isotomic-dichotomous
ascomata: absent
secondary metabolites: absent
primary photobiont: present
secondary photobionts (eg in cephalodia): absent
primary photobiont: cyanobacterial
